    HELP ! My laptop crashed

    and it can't come back up. Hard disk failed.
    Now, I have a bright shiny new Dell with a REAL comm port, but I don't have my software anymore for the MX-700 remote that came with my C2.
    I MAY be able to retrieve some data from the hard disk, but I'm not counting on it.
    Will I be OK just downloading the MX Editor from the Parasound website ?
    I thought that somewhere along the line there was a firmware update into the remote itself.
    Just being extra cautious here. I don't want to screw something up and have to go out and buy a newer URC remote.

    Absolutely, you can download the MXEditor program from the site. Works great. (just doesn't do updates anymore, since URC locked updates for non-dealer people)

    Just curious, what Dell model did you get that has a serial port? I haven't had 100% luck using my laptop with a USB to Serial adapter.

      I got the Dell Latitude D830 with Windows XP Pro. Sweet machine.
      And just for the reference, when I had MX Editor on my old laptop, I used the Belkin USB to Serial adaptor. It worked MOST of the time, but I remember that I had to connect everything up before launching MX-Editor or it wouldn't always communicate with the remote.

        Yeah, there's a thread somewhere here in the Club that I made a long time back about USB/serial adapters. One didn't work for me at all, but a different model from Radio Shack works pretty good for me for MX Editor. Now, when I do firmware updates, the cable gave me fits, though, so often I had to drag my desktop down into my theater to do the last of the update.
